Most and least expensive townhouses sold in Fairfax County (October 2023)

Here in Fairfax County, real estate is a spectator sport. Let’s take a look at some of the most and least expensive townhouses sold last month (October 2023).

Most expensive townhouses sold

  1. 12079 Kinsley Place — Reston Town Center — $1,250,000 (3 beds | 3.5 baths | 2,466 sq. ft.)
  2. 6638 Madison Mclean Dr — McLean — $1,191,000 (3 beds | 3.5 baths | 3,024 sq. ft.)
  3. 3884 Rainier Dr — Fair Oaks — $1,165,000 (4 beds | 4.5 baths | 3,488 sq. ft.)

Least expensive townhouses sold*

  1. 3803 Monte Vista Place Unit D — Mount Vernon — $210,000 (2 beds | 1.5 baths | 1,100 sq. ft.)
  2. 8702 Walutes Cir Unit B — Mount Vernon — $250,500 (2 beds | 1 baths | 966 sq. ft.)
  3. 8412 Fuerte Ct Unit 135 — Woodlawn-Mt Vernon — $252,500 (3 beds | 1.5 baths | 1,178 sq. ft.)

*Minimum home value of $200,000 set to exclude certain land sales, retirement condos, properties with expiring ground leases, etc.
